{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,6,10]],"date-time":"2026-06-10T15:02:45Z","timestamp":1781103765559,"version":"3.54.1"},"reference-count":30,"publisher":"IGI Global Scientific Publishing","issue":"4","content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2013,10,1]]},"abstract":"<p>Web services have emerged as a major technology for deploying automated interactions between distributed and heterogeneous applications. The main advantage of Web services composition is the possibility of creating value-added services by combining existing ones to achieve customized tasks. How to combine these services efficiently into an arrangement that is both functionally sound and architecturally realizable is a very challenging topic that has founded a significant research area within computer science. A great deal of recent Web-related research has concentrated on dynamic Web service composition. Most of proposed models for dynamic composition use semantic descriptions of Web services through the construction of domain ontology. In this paper, we present our approach to dynamically produce composite services. It is based on the use of two Artificial Intelligence (AI) techniques: Case-Based Reasoning (CBR) and AI planning. Our motivating scenario concerns a national system for the monitoring of childhood immunization.<\/p>","DOI":"10.4018\/ijitwe.2013100103","type":"journal-article","created":{"date-parts":[[2014,3,12]],"date-time":"2014-03-12T09:37:09Z","timestamp":1394617029000},"page":"36-47","source":"Crossref","is-referenced-by-count":0,"title":["Applying CBR Over an AI Planner for Dynamic Web Service Composition"],"prefix":"10.4018","volume":"8","author":[{"given":"Fouad","family":"Henni","sequence":"first","affiliation":[{"name":"LIO Laboratory Oran, University of Mostaganem, Algeria"}],"role":[{"vocabulary":"crossref","role":"author"}]},{"given":"Baghdad","family":"Atmani","sequence":"additional","affiliation":[{"name":"LIO Laboratory Oran, University of Oran, Algeria"}],"role":[{"vocabulary":"crossref","role":"author"}]}],"member":"2432","reference":[{"issue":"1","key":"ijitwe.2013100103-0","first-page":"39","article-title":"Case-based reasoning: Foundational issues, methodological variations, and system approaches.","volume":"7","author":"A.Aamodt","year":"1994","journal-title":"Artificial Intelligence Communications Journal"},{"key":"ijitwe.2013100103-1","doi-asserted-by":"crossref","unstructured":"Agarwal, V., Chafle, G., Mittal, S., & Strivastava, B. (2008). Understanding approaches for web service composition and execution. In Proceedings of the First Bangalore Annual Compute Conference (COMPUTE 2008), Bangalore, India (pp. 1-8).","DOI":"10.1145\/1341771.1341773"},{"key":"ijitwe.2013100103-2","doi-asserted-by":"publisher","DOI":"10.1504\/IJWGS.2006.010805"},{"key":"ijitwe.2013100103-3","doi-asserted-by":"crossref","unstructured":"Albert, P., Henocque, L., & Kleiner, M. (2008). An end-to-end configuration-based framework for automatic SWS composition. In Proceedings of the 20th IEEE International Conference on Tools with Artificial Intelligence, (ICTAI 2008), Dayton, Ohio (Vol. 1, pp. 351-358).","DOI":"10.1109\/ICTAI.2008.145"},{"issue":"2","key":"ijitwe.2013100103-4","first-page":"171","article-title":"Knowledge discovery in database: Induction graph and cellular automaton.","volume":"26","author":"B.Atmani","year":"2007","journal-title":"Computing and Informatics"},{"key":"ijitwe.2013100103-5","unstructured":"Carman, M., Serafini, L., & Traverso, P. (2003). Web service composition as planning. In Proceedings of the Workshop on Planning for Web Services (ICAPS 2003), Trento, Italy."},{"issue":"2","key":"ijitwe.2013100103-6","first-page":"35","article-title":"Automated web service composition with knowledge approach. Information Sciences and Technologies.","volume":"2","author":"Z.\u010eur\u010d\u00edk","year":"2010","journal-title":"Bulletin of the ACM Slovakia"},{"key":"ijitwe.2013100103-7","unstructured":"Farrell, J., & Lausen, H. (2007). Semantic annotations for WSDL and XML schema. Retrieved August, 25, 2012, from http:\/\/www.w3.org\/TR\/sawsdl\/"},{"key":"ijitwe.2013100103-8","author":"M.Ghallab","year":"1998","journal-title":"PDDL - The planning domain definition language, Version 1.2 (Tech. rep. CVC TR-98-003\/DCS TR-1165)"},{"issue":"1","key":"ijitwe.2013100103-9","first-page":"319","article-title":"A domain-independent algorithm for plan adaptation.","volume":"2","author":"S.Hanks","year":"1994","journal-title":"Journal of Artificial Intelligence Research"},{"key":"ijitwe.2013100103-10","doi-asserted-by":"crossref","unstructured":"Hu, J., & Feng, Z. (2009). Automated composition of semantic web services using case-based planning. In Proceedings of the International Forum on Information Technology and Applications, (IFITA 2009), Tianjin, China (pp. 246-251).","DOI":"10.1109\/IFITA.2009.302"},{"key":"ijitwe.2013100103-11","doi-asserted-by":"crossref","unstructured":"Klusch, M., & Gerber, A. (2005). Semantic web service composition planning with OWLS-XPlan. In Proceedings of the First International AAAI Fall Symposium on Agents and the Semantic Web, (AAAI 2005), Arlington, VA.","DOI":"10.1109\/WI-IATW.2006.68"},{"key":"ijitwe.2013100103-12","doi-asserted-by":"crossref","unstructured":"Klusch, M., & Gerber, A. (2006). Evaluation of service composition planning with OWLS-XPlan. In Proceedings from IEEE\/WIC\/ACM 2006: International Conference on Web Intelligence and Intelligent Agent Technology (pp. 117-120).","DOI":"10.1109\/WI-IATW.2006.68"},{"key":"ijitwe.2013100103-13","doi-asserted-by":"crossref","unstructured":"Lajmi, S., Ghedira, C., Ghedira, K., & Benslimane, D. (2009). CBR method for web service composition. Lecture Notes in Computer Science. Advanced Internet Based Systems and Applications, 4879, 314-326.","DOI":"10.1007\/978-3-642-01350-8_29"},{"issue":"5","key":"ijitwe.2013100103-14","doi-asserted-by":"crossref","first-page":"540","DOI":"10.20965\/jaciii.2010.p0540","article-title":"Using planning and case-based reasoning for service composition.","volume":"14","author":"C. L.Lee","year":"2010","journal-title":"Journal of Advanced Computational Intelligence and Intelligent Informatics"},{"key":"ijitwe.2013100103-15","doi-asserted-by":"publisher","DOI":"10.1007\/s11280-007-0033-x"},{"key":"ijitwe.2013100103-16","doi-asserted-by":"crossref","unstructured":"Mendes, E., Mosley, N., & Watson, I. (2002). A comparison of case-based reasoning approaches to web hypermedia project cost estimation. In Proceedings of the 11th International World-Wide Web Conference (WWW 2002), Honolulu, HI (pp. 272-280).","DOI":"10.1145\/511446.511482"},{"key":"ijitwe.2013100103-17","doi-asserted-by":"publisher","DOI":"10.1109\/MIC.2004.58"},{"key":"ijitwe.2013100103-18","unstructured":"Miller, J., Verma, K., Shelth, A., Aggarwal, R., & Sivashanmugan, K. (2004). WSDL-S: Adding semantics to WSDL white paper. Technical report, Large Scale Distributed Information Systems."},{"key":"ijitwe.2013100103-19","doi-asserted-by":"publisher","DOI":"10.1109\/MIS.2008.59"},{"key":"ijitwe.2013100103-20","doi-asserted-by":"crossref","unstructured":"Osman, T., Thakker, D., & Al-Dabass, D. (2006). Semantic-driven matchmaking of web services using case-based reasoning. In Proceedings of the IEEE International Conference on Web Services (ICWS 2006), Chicago, IL (pp. 29-36).","DOI":"10.1109\/ICWS.2006.118"},{"key":"ijitwe.2013100103-21","doi-asserted-by":"crossref","unstructured":"Peer, J. (2004). A PDDL based tool for automatic web service composition. Lecture Notes in Computer Science. Principles and Practice of Semantic Web Reasoning, 3208, 149-163.","DOI":"10.1007\/978-3-540-30122-6_11"},{"key":"ijitwe.2013100103-22","unstructured":"PonHarshavardhan. Akilandeswari, J., & Manjari, M. (2011). Dynamic web service composition problems and solution -A survey. In Proceedings of the Second International Conference on Information Systems and Technology (ICIST 2011), Nanjing, China (pp. 1-5)."},{"key":"ijitwe.2013100103-23","doi-asserted-by":"crossref","unstructured":"Rao, J., & Su, X. (2004). A survey of automated web service composition methods. In Proceedings of the First International Workshop on Semantic Web Services and Web Process Composition (SWSWPC 2004), San Diego, CA (pp. 43-54).","DOI":"10.1007\/978-3-540-30581-1_5"},{"key":"ijitwe.2013100103-24","doi-asserted-by":"crossref","unstructured":"Recio-Garcia, J., Diaz-Agudo, B., Gonzalez-Calero, P., & Sanchez, A. (2006). Ontology based CBR with jCOLIBRI. In Proceedings of the Twenty-sixth SGAI International Conference on Innovative Techniques and Applications of Artificial Intelligence, Applications and Innovations in Intelligent Systems (AI 2006) (Vol. 14, pp. 149\u2013162).","DOI":"10.1007\/978-1-84628-666-7_12"},{"key":"ijitwe.2013100103-25","doi-asserted-by":"publisher","DOI":"10.1016\/j.scico.2007.02.004"},{"key":"ijitwe.2013100103-26","doi-asserted-by":"publisher","DOI":"10.1016\/j.websem.2004.06.005"},{"key":"ijitwe.2013100103-27","doi-asserted-by":"crossref","unstructured":"Sivasubramanian, S. P., Ilavarasan, E., & Vadivelou, G. (2009). Dynamic web service composition: Challenges and techniques. In Proceedings of the International Conference on Intelligent Agent & Multi-Agent Systems (IAMA 2009), Channai, India (pp. 1-8).","DOI":"10.1109\/IAMA.2009.5228066"},{"key":"ijitwe.2013100103-28","unstructured":"Srivastava, B., & Koehler, J. (2003). Web service composition current solutions and open problems. In Proceedings of the Workshop on Planning for Web Services (ICAPS 2003), Trento, Italy (pp. 28-35)."},{"key":"ijitwe.2013100103-29","doi-asserted-by":"publisher","DOI":"10.1017\/S0269888900007098"}],"container-title":["International Journal of Information Technology and Web Engineering"],"original-title":[],"language":"ng","link":[{"URL":"https:\/\/www.igi-global.com\/viewtitle.aspx?TitleId=103165","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2022,6,1]],"date-time":"2022-06-01T23:07:55Z","timestamp":1654124875000},"score":1,"resource":{"primary":{"URL":"https:\/\/services.igi-global.com\/resolvedoi\/resolve.aspx?doi=10.4018\/ijitwe.2013100103"}},"subtitle":[""],"short-title":[],"issued":{"date-parts":[[2013,10,1]]},"references-count":30,"journal-issue":{"issue":"4","published-print":{"date-parts":[[2013,10]]}},"URL":"https:\/\/doi.org\/10.4018\/ijitwe.2013100103","relation":{},"ISSN":["1554-1045","1554-1053"],"issn-type":[{"value":"1554-1045","type":"print"},{"value":"1554-1053","type":"electronic"}],"subject":[],"published":{"date-parts":[[2013,10,1]]}}}